#859238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#859238 is composed of 52.2% red, 57.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.6%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 68.7 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 39.6%. #859238 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#0b2500.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#859238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#859238 has RGB values of R:133, G:146,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 8753720.

Shades and Tints of #859238
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040402 is the darkest color, while #fafb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#859238
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696b5f is the less saturated color, while #acc802 is the most saturated one.
